Tragedy

The opposite of strategy is not the absence of strategy, rather it is tragedy such that ways are found of using available means to achieve undesirable ends. People use what they have to get what they don’t want or arrive where they don’t want to be or shape a future they didn’t want. When all the available means necessary to accomplish something good are used to accomplish something bad, this is tragic, not strategic.
That’s not a strategy, it’s a tragedy.
